Ethical Problems of AI and Modern GPT Technologies

The rise of AI and GPT technologies presents significant ethical and security challenges. A major issue is bias in AI systems, where algorithms may reflect and perpetuate societal prejudices, leading to unfair treatment in areas like hiring or criminal justice. Additionally, misinformation generated by AI-powered systems poses risks, as GPT models can produce convincing but false or misleading content.

 

Privacy concerns are another challenge, with AI being used to collect and analyze personal data without consent. Moreover, AI-generated deepfake videos and voice impersonation pose risks to credibility and authenticity, enabling fraud and misinformation by mimicking real individuals' faces and voices. In a broader sense, the potential for job displacement due to automation raises economic and social concerns. Let’s look at some more challenges:

 

Unjustified Actions: Algorithmic decision-making often relies on correlations without establishing causality, which can lead to erroneous outcomes. Inauthentic correlations may be misleading, and actions based on population trends may not apply to individuals. Acting on such data without confirming causality can cause inaccurate and unfair results.
